KEITH MACK, LEWIS & ALLISON v. BORAKS

No. 84-2234.

483 So.2d 560 (1986)

KEITH, MACK, LEWIS & ALLISON, Appellant, v. I. Jeffrey BORAKS and Rona L. Boraks, Appellees.

District Court of Appeal of Florida, Fourth District.

February 26, 1986.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

R. Hugh Lumpkin, of Keith, Mack, Lewis & Allison, Miami, for appellant.

Melvyn Schlesser, of Isenberg & Schlesser, P.A., Fort Lauderdale, for appellees.


PER CURIAM.

The transaction giving rise to this litigation began when the Borakses entered into an agreement with a contractor (not a party to this appeal) for the construction and purchase of a custom built home. During construction, the Borakses requested certain features not covered by the agreement.
